Problem 1

Ape's Concert inside the Rainbow Mist is a maze-like space where traveling in either direction brings a person back to the starting point.

What conflict does Rapa Nui still face after the escape party joins the Pumpkin Pirates in Episode 141?

View explanation

Rapa Nui cannot accept the reality that 50 years have passed outside the mist. In addition to the physical challenge of escaping the maze, he must confront the psychological shock that time has moved on for his friends and homeland. Abandoning the treasure is not the central conflict.

Problem 2

In Episode 142, Henzo and Rapa Nui try to face each other after decades apart while Luffy is flying around inside Ape's Concert.

Which sequence correctly describes what happens between the misunderstanding being resolved and Luffy and Rapa Nui disappearing into a gap in space?

View explanation

Usopp clears up the misunderstanding, and Henzo and Rapa Nui are about to shake hands in tears. At that moment, the flying Luffy collides with Rapa Nui, and the two disappear into a gap in space. The mediator of the reconciliation and the cause of the accident are different people.

Problem 3

Wetton uses the Rainbow Tower to carry treasure out of Ape's Concert, but an angry Luffy blocks his path.

What directly triggers the collapse of Ape's Concert in Episode 143?

View explanation

After Luffy corners him, Wetton flees and blows up the Rainbow Tower. The blast disrupts the balance of the unusual space and causes Ape's Concert to collapse. Luffy pressures Wetton, but Wetton's explosion is the action that directly destabilizes the space.

Problem 4

A giant galleon falls from the sky, Nami's Log Pose points upward, and Luffy finds a map marked with a Sky Island.

What do Luffy, Zoro, and Sanji do to investigate these clues?

View explanation

The three investigate the galleon on the seafloor, seeking more information from the vessel that fell out of the sky and sank. Instead of drawing a conclusion from the Log Pose and map alone, they examine the physical evidence. Their purpose is not merely to recover treasure.

Problem 5

In Episode 145, while the Straw Hats encounter sudden darkness and gigantic shadows, someone appears before Buggy's crew elsewhere.

What happens at the same time that the Straw Hats flee the giant figures aboard the Going Merry?

View explanation

Parallel to the Straw Hats' encounter with the giant turtle and enormous shadows, Ace boards Buggy's ship while the crew is partying. Ace does not return to the Going Merry to fight the shadows; his arrival occurs in a different location.

Problem 6

Luffy, Zoro, and Nami enter Mock Town, a lawless port crowded with pirates where fights are an everyday occurrence.

What does Nami make Luffy and Zoro promise before they meet Bellamy in the tavern?

View explanation

To keep Luffy and Zoro from causing trouble in violent Mock Town, Nami makes them promise not to fight. The promise is not a truce with one particular opponent. It becomes the constraint that explains why they refuse to retaliate when Bellamy's group attacks them in the next episode.

Problem 7

Bellamy's group denies the value of dreams, mocks the Straw Hats for seeking Sky Island, and attacks Luffy and Zoro in the tavern.

Why do the two refuse to fight back even after being badly hurt in Episode 147?

View explanation

The two are not surrendering because they cannot oppose Bellamy. They endure the attack because they are honoring the promise they made to Nami when entering Mock Town. The ridicule of their dream is provocation, but the promise is the direct reason for their restraint, not a bargain for information.

Problem 8

Seeking information about Sky Island, the crew visits Mont Blanc Cricket, a man driven out of Mock Town for speaking about his dream.

How is Cricket connected to the North Blue tale Noland the Liar?

View explanation

Cricket is a descendant of Mont Blanc Noland, the protagonist of Noland the Liar. The crew visits him for information about Sky Island after learning that talk of his dream caused him to be driven from town. Cricket is not Noland himself surviving from the period of the tale; he inherits Noland's family line.

Problem 9

Cricket explains that if Sky Island lies within the Imperial Cumulus Cloud, the crew must ride the Knock Up Stream that will erupt in the sea to the south the next day.

Why does the crew enter the forest to capture a South Bird?

View explanation

The South Bird's habit of always facing south can guide the crew toward the southern sea where the Knock Up Stream will appear. The bird does not carry the ship into the sky; it supports the directional part of a navigation plan that must reach a time-limited current.

Problem 10

While Luffy's group searches the midnight forest for the South Bird and faces gigantic insects, a separate attack takes place at the Saruyama Alliance's base.

Which combination correctly identifies the attacker, his power, and what is lost in Episode 150?

View explanation

Bellamy uses the power of the Spring-Spring Fruit to defeat Cricket and the Saruyama Alliance and steal their gold. The enormous insects obstruct the Straw Hats' search in the forest, but they do not defeat the alliance. Neither the South Bird nor the Log Pose is the stolen item.
